> Fix bypass clock source for a few DPLLs.
>
> On DRA7x/OMAP5, for a few DPLLs, both CLKINP and CLKINPULOW are connected
> to a mux and the output from mux is routed to the bypass clkout.
> Add a mux-clock as bypass clock with CLKINP and CLKINPULOW as parents.
